Output d8efca65bff2ffc97a4e4f6bddbc7878812e23cd401b5ed7a296c28dfa9ff976:0

value
45235
script pubkey
OP_0 OP_PUSHBYTES_20 711b32bbaf8ac54a13925801830971c43933bd1e
address
bc1qwydn9wa03tz55yujtqqcxzt3csun80g7awrz8g
transaction
d8efca65bff2ffc97a4e4f6bddbc7878812e23cd401b5ed7a296c28dfa9ff976
confirmations
10486
spent
true